You start of in the swamps of Louisiana, land of the Voodoo. I noticed straight away that the game's graphics are terrible. They are very greyish and there is also a lot of "fog". Why a 3d actiongame on the gamecube would need so much fog is beyond me. Perhaps because it was designed for the inferior playstation 2 and then ported to the gamecube.
The gameplay is equally terrible. Rayne, the main character who is a female vampire, has a grappling hook to draw her victims to her. She doesn't really need it because she can also just run to them, jump on them and then, with much pleasure, suck them dry. You get the idea. The main difficulty is navigating the levels and finding the exit. At the end of the Louisiana level there is a levelboss who (or which) is very hard to beat. You'll be tempted to quit playing and miss the better part of the game.
If you succeed in defeating the Louisiana swamp-thing the nazi's make their appearance. Rayne goes to Argentina where a certain Herr Nazi Doctor tries to resurrect a vampire bloodgod. Rayne obtains a hitlist of the nazi officers she needs to take down. Hunting them down and slashing them to pieces is actually a lot of fun, despite of the graphics. The last part of the game takes place in a German castle and even the graphics start getting better here. Some of the bossfights are a challenge and there are even some gameplay variations like a mech-battle. After finishing he game i have grown accustomed to Rayne and i did not regret pulling her out of the budget section.
